New DialByPhoto Build - Version 0.9984


Whats New:
Enhancement: If in power save mode and you press the phone button, it will now stay in DialByPhoto instead of going to the default phone app
Enhancement: Green button can now be used to dial the number of the photo contact or number in focus
Enhancement: Adding a new photo contact now adds it to the end of the list

International characters

I downloaded this application and it seems to be a great thing, but i'm hungarian and i'm using non-english characters in contact names and agenda entries like á.é.�*.ó.ő,etc. These characters are still missing from the font set, so i cannot use this program to replace the original one.

Edit:
Ok, i found that setting the font set to the original Palm ones will help, but those fonts are ugly and it would be great if you could set the font sizes for each text type (e.g. contact name, agenda entry, menu item, etc.)
